    of old
    [of old]
    definition
    1. in or belonging to the past:
      "he was more reticent than of old"
      • starting long ago; for a long time:
        "they knew him of old"

    What does old mean in a sentence?Use the adjective old to describe someone who's been alive for a long time. When you're 30, 60 seems old, and when you're 60, 90 seems old. When you're 90, face it, you're old! The adjective old also means former. It can be fun to visit your favorite teachers at your old elementary school, or to drive through your old neighborhood.
    What is Old English?Old English is the name given to the earliest recorded stage of the English language, up to approximately 1150AD (when the Middle English period is generally taken to have begun).
